Текущее время: Вт, июл 15 2025, 07:18

Часовой пояс: UTC + 3 часа


Правила форума


ВНИМАНИЕ!

Вопросы по SAP Query и Quick View - сюда



Начать новую тему Ответить на тему  [ Сообщений: 12 ] 
Автор Сообщение
 Заголовок сообщения: HR: ФМ для создания объекта (инфотип 1000) и пр.
СообщениеДобавлено: Чт, июн 01 2006, 09:09 
Гость
Всем здрасьте.
Народ, подскажите плиз, с помощью каких ФМ-ов можно программно создать объект (инфотип 1000), его вербальное описание в разных подтипах (инфотип 1002) и корректно связать объект XX с объектом YY связью ZZ (инфотип 1001)?


Принять этот ответ
Вернуться к началу
  
 
 Заголовок сообщения:
СообщениеДобавлено: Чт, июн 01 2006, 10:12 
Гость
Сам спрашиваю, сам отвечаю. :)

Создание объекта (инфотип 1000) - ФМ RH_OBJECT_CREATE.
Создание вербальных описаний объекта (инфотип 1002) - ФМ RH_OBJECT_DESCRIPTION_WRITE.

Осталось решить вопрос о корректной привязке с другими объектами. Какой это ФМ?


Принять этот ответ
Вернуться к началу
  
 
 Заголовок сообщения:
СообщениеДобавлено: Пт, июн 02 2006, 13:18 
Старший специалист
Старший специалист

Зарегистрирован:
Вт, авг 17 2004, 08:49
Сообщения: 319
Откуда: Мариуполь
Вам нужно ввести строчку в таблицу hrp1001. Так что поищите в функциональной группе для RH_INSERT_INFTY


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ения:
СообщениеДобавлено: Пт, июн 02 2006, 14:16 
Почетный гуру
Почетный гуру
Аватара пользователя

Зарегистрирован:
Сб, сен 25 2004, 16:30
Сообщения: 1368
Откуда: Москва
Пол: Мужской
Вот эти должны подойти:
RH_CUT_INFTY_1001_EXT
RH_DELETE_INFTY_1001_EXT
RH_INSERT_INFTY_1001_EXT
RH_UPDATE_INFTY_1001_EXT

_________________
С уважением, Сергей Королев


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ения:
СообщениеДобавлено: Пт, июн 02 2006, 14:32 
Гость
Ага, а я раскопал такой ФМ - RH_RELATION_WRITE. Попробовал его - связь с объектом получилась (результат видно в транзакции pp01). Хм, интересно, каким ФМ пользоваться корректнее? Или это дело вкуса? :?


Принять этот ответ
Вернуться к началу
  
 
 Заголовок сообщения:
СообщениеДобавлено: Пт, июн 02 2006, 15:01 
Почетный гуру
Почетный гуру
Аватара пользователя

Зарегистрирован:
Сб, сен 25 2004, 16:30
Сообщения: 1368
Откуда: Москва
Пол: Мужской
Точно, я им тоже пользовался, но потом отказался, а почему, уже не помню... :oops:

_________________
С уважением, Сергей Королев


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ения:
СообщениеДобавлено: Пт, июн 02 2006, 16:03 
Гость
ФМ RH_RELATION_WRITE создает только одну запись связи.

По идее, односторонние связи - специфичны (например, объектXX--Bсвязь-->объектYY).
Чаще требуется создавать еще и (объектYY--Aсвязь-->объектXX).
Может в этом закавыка?


Принять этот ответ
Вернуться к началу
  
 
 Заголовок сообщения:
СообщениеДобавлено: Пт, июн 02 2006, 16:05 
Гуру-модератор
Гуру-модератор
Аватара пользователя

Зарегистрирован:
Пн, окт 11 2004, 13:16
Сообщения: 1790
Jimona написал(а):
ФМ RH_RELATION_WRITE создает только одну запись связи.

По идее, односторонние связи - специфичны (например, объектXX--Bсвязь-->объектYY).
Чаще требуется создавать еще и (объектYY--Aсвязь-->объектXX).
Может в этом закавыка?

В настройках указывается создавать ли автоматически обратную связь, проверь это.

_________________
/nex


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ения:
СообщениеДобавлено: Пт, июн 02 2006, 16:06 
Гость
Спасибо всем!


Принять этот ответ
Вернуться к началу
  
 
 Заголовок сообщения:
СообщениеДобавлено: Пт, июн 02 2006, 16:08 
Гуру-модератор
Гуру-модератор
Аватара пользователя

Зарегистрирован:
Пн, окт 11 2004, 13:16
Сообщения: 1790
Jimona написал(а):
Спасибо всем!

С ФМ RH_RELATION_WRITE получилось?

_________________
/nex


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ения:
СообщениеДобавлено: Пт, июн 02 2006, 16:29 
Гость
Цитата:
В настройках указывается создавать ли автоматически обратную связь, проверь это.
Нет, такого я не увидел. Там импортируются данные о способе записи данных (синхронно, асинхронно, в диалоге и пр.), и чек-бокс (вносить ли в авторы изменения юзера). И две таблицы - одна с данными (которые сам составляешь), а во вторую скидываются записи по тем или иным причинам не записавшиеся в БД. Вроде всё. :?

P.S. Это про ФМ RH_RELATION_WRITE


Принять этот ответ
Вернуться к началу
  
 
 Заголовок сообщения:
СообщениеДобавлено: Пт, июн 02 2006, 17:12 
Гуру-модератор
Гуру-модератор
Аватара пользователя

Зарегистрирован:
Пн, окт 11 2004, 13:16
Сообщения: 1790
Jimona написал(а):
Нет, такого я не увидел. Там импортируются данные о способе записи данных (синхронно, асинхронно, в диалоге и пр.), и чек-бокс (вносить ли в авторы изменения юзера). И две таблицы - одна с данными (которые сам составляешь), а во вторую скидываются записи по тем или иным причинам не записавшиеся в БД. Вроде всё. :?

P.S. Это про ФМ RH_RELATION_WRITE

Сори, с толку сбил, попутал я - нет таких настроек.

Если руками создавать, то связь автоматом создается в обе стороны при соединении двух внутренних объектов (например O и S) и только в одну сторону, если соединение производится с внешним объектом (напр. O и K).
ФМ по идее так и должен работать - не могу проверить, системы нет под руками.

_________________
/nex


Принять этот ответ
Вернуться к началу
 Профиль  
 
Показать сообщения за:  Поле сортировки  
Начать новую тему Ответить на тему  [ Сообщений: 12 ] 

Часовой пояс: UTC + 3 часа


Кто сейчас на конференции

Сейчас этот форум просматривают: Google [Bot], Yandex [Bot]


Вы не можете начинать темы
Вы не можете отвечать на сообщения
Вы не можете редактировать свои сообщения
Вы не можете удалять свои сообщения
Вы не можете добавлять вложения

Найти:
Перейти:  
cron
Powered by phpBB © 2000, 2002, 2005, 2007 phpBB Group
Русская поддержка phpBB